Output 838627a3d262fd1881ac2f4242a84f561967682d0cb95c499f6fc4a4c0b00568:1

value
34470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21ee1ded45020d64636fad89047a752bb1efd75 OP_EQUAL
address
3KPS1VuHc5G4LdqA271UbqhMsvPJmnqpiz
transaction
838627a3d262fd1881ac2f4242a84f561967682d0cb95c499f6fc4a4c0b00568
spent
true